You need some decent shocks. Tokico Blues are meant to be OEM replacement shocks, they're just as crappy as stock shocks when you're lowered more than a couple inches.

One other item that I am sure everyone overlooked are the tires that the car is riding on.

If your tires have a stiff side wall then the ride will be a bit harder

If your tires have soft side wall then that could also contribute to the bounce especially in conjunction to stiff spring rates and blown shocks.

think about a Hydraulic car and you will get the idea.

I myself ride on 35 series tires and I don't think my car is stiff or bouncy with 8k springs in the front and 10k in the rear full coil overs.

Oh and just because the items are sold on eBay does not mean it's crap, in general when people say ebay stuff....everyone are referring to stuff with no name like tsudo, drop zone, & etc.
